Output 8d12df5376de25611157b2f0a5fd6b5890ea8d7650f847f92e4a443ca3fa4b99:1

value
1950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2b82206d37050fcabd8b6d2231fe839f39779e5 OP_EQUAL
address
3NMoDgCuCBQemWBy3wjPJLKAQgnkQZquqs
transaction
8d12df5376de25611157b2f0a5fd6b5890ea8d7650f847f92e4a443ca3fa4b99
confirmations
303169
spent
true